Baconsthorpe Immigration Statistics
These figures for Country of Birth for the residents of Baconsthorpe are from the UK Census of 2011. Since Baconsthorpe has a higher level of residents born in the UK than the national average and a lower rate of residents either born in other EU countries or outside the EU, it does not have a significant immigrant population.
Country | North Norfolk | England |
---|---|---|
United Kingdom | 95.9% | 86.2% |
Rebublic of Ireland | 0.3% | 0.7% |
Other EU Countries | 1.7% | 3.7% |
Outside the EU | 2.1% | 9.4% |
Baconsthorpe Education Statistics
These statistics are for the highest level education obtained by the residents of Baconsthorpe and are from the UK Census of 2011. Baconsthorpe has a high level of residents with either no qualifications or qualifications equal to 1 or more GCSE at grade D or below, than the national average.
Qualification | North Norfolk | England |
---|---|---|
No Qualifications | 27.5% | 22.5% |
Level 1 | 14.1% | 13.3% |
Level 2 | 16.2% | 15.2% |
Apprenticeship | 4.7% | 3.6% |
Level 3 | 10.5% | 12.4% |
Level 4 | 22.3% | 27.4% |
Other | 4.7% | 5.7% |
Baconsthorpe Social Grade & Occcupation Statistics
Social grade is a classification based on occupation and it enables a household and all its members to be classified according to the job of the main income earner. Baconsthorpe has 20% less Higher and Intermediate managerial, administrative or professional households than the national average.
Grade | North Norfolk | England |
---|---|---|
AB | 17.54% | 22.96% |
C1 | 27.14% | 30.92% |
C2 | 28.57% | 20.64% |
DE | 26.74% | 25.49% |

Baconsthorpe General Health Statistics
The respondents of the 2011 Census were asked to rate their health. These are the results for Baconsthorpe. The percentage of residents in Baconsthorpe rating their health as 'very good' is less than the national average. Also the percentage of residents in Baconsthorpe rating their health as 'very bad' is more than the national average, suggesting that the health of the residents of Baconsthorpe is generally worse than in the average person in England.
Health | North Norfolk | England |
---|---|---|
Very Good | 38.92% | 47.17% |
Good | 37.77% | 34.22% |
Fair | 17.15% | 13.12% |
Bad | 4.77% | 4.25% |
Very Bad | 1.39% | 1.25% |
Baconsthorpe Age Distribution Statistics
The population of Baconsthorpe as a whole, is older than the national average. The population of Baconsthorpe is also older than the average, making Baconsthorpe a older persons location.
Age | North Norfolk | England |
---|---|---|
Age 0 to 4 | 4.3% | 6.3% |
Age 5 to 9 | 4.1% | 5.6% |
Age 10 to14 | 4.9% | 5.8% |
Age 15 to 17 | 3.4% | 3.7% |
Age 18 to 24 | 6.4% | 9.4% |
Age 25 to 29 | 4.2% | 6.9% |
Age 30 to 44 | 14.4% | 20.6% |
Age 45 to 59 | 20.6% | 19.4% |
Age 60 to 64 | 9.1% | 6% |
Age 65 to 74 | 14.6% | 8.6% |
Age 75 to 84 | 10.1% | 5.5% |
Age 85 and over | 4.1% | 2.3% |
Mean Age | 47.5 | 39.3 |
Median Age | 51 | 39 |
